Understanding the "No Exam" Misconception
The term "driving license course without examination" is, in some methods, a misnomer. It doesn't imply a complimentary pass to licensure without showing driving efficiency. Rather, it generally refers to courses where the effective completion of the program, as certified by the driving school, is accepted by the appropriate licensing authority in lieu of the standard government-administered driving test.

Believe of it as moving the assessment approach. Instead of a single, definitive practical test conducted by a government examiner, these courses often integrate continuous assessment throughout the training duration. Trainers monitor student development in useful driving sessions, evaluating their abilities, knowledge, and accountable driving practices on an ongoing basis. The final "test" in this context becomes the overall efficiency demonstrated throughout the course, culminating in the trainer's certification of competency upon successful completion.

This technique relies heavily on the quality and accreditation of the driving school and the course itself. Licensing authorities that recognize these courses have typically established rigorous criteria and oversight to guarantee that the training is extensive, standardized, and effectively prepares chauffeurs for safe roadway usage.

While specifics might differ depending upon the place and the driving school, here's a general overview of how these courses typically operate:
Enrollment in a Certified Driving School: The initial step is to register in a driving school that is formally recognized and accredited to use exam-exempt courses by the local licensing authority. This certification is essential, as just courses from authorized companies will be accepted for license issuance without a government test.Comprehensive Curriculum: The course will typically involve a structured curriculum incorporating both theoretical and practical parts.Class Sessions (Theory): These sessions cover road guidelines, traffic signs, automobile security, defensive driving techniques, threat awareness, and legal aspects of driving.Practical Driving Lessons: A substantial part of the course will be devoted to practical driving lessons, conducted under the supervision of licensed trainers. These lessons will cover a large range of driving abilities, consisting of lorry control, maneuvering, parking, browsing various roadway conditions, and handling numerous traffic situations.Continuous Assessment and Instructor Evaluation: Throughout the practical driving lessons, trainers will constantly examine the student's progress. This examination is not simply based upon pass/fail criteria for individual lessons, but rather an ongoing evaluation of abilities, understanding, and safe driving behavior.Last Practical Assessment: While there may not be a different 'federal government driving test,' the course will likely culminate in a last practical assessment conducted by the driving school trainer. This assessment will assess the student's general driving competency and identify if they meet the required standards for safe driving.Course Completion Certificate: Upon effective conclusion of the course and the last assessment, the driving school will provide a certificate of completion. This certificate is the essential to obtaining a driving license without taking the standard government driving test.License Application Process: With the course conclusion certificate, the trainee can then look for their driving license at the designated licensing authority. The certificate generally acts as evidence of driving proficiency, effectively waiving the requirement for the basic driving test. However, other licensing requirements like vision tests, understanding tests (composed tests on traffic rules and regulations), and application fees still usually use.Important Considerations and Caveats
